Land of the Eagles

Event Details

Loch Druidibeg is one of the best places in the Uists to see both golden and sea eagles, alongside hen harriers, short-eared owls, merlin and rare divers as well as a wonderfully rich variety of plants.

Cost for this walk is £3 for RSPB Members, £6 for non-members. Children go free. Please pay for this event on the day, we can only accept cash payments.
